Cytori Therapeutics wins new Celution system patent for spinal disc disease

Cytori Therapeutics, a developer of medical products and devices, has received USpatent for Celution system based methods of treating musculoskeletal disorders such as spinal disc disease.

The patent covers the therapeutic use of adipose-derived stem and regenerative cells for promoting repair and regeneration of the spinal disc and formation of bone, cartilage, skeletal muscle, tendon and ligaments.

Marc Hedrick, president of Cytori, said: “This addition to our patent portfolio significantly expands protection for the therapeutic uses of the Celution system output for orthopedics, one of the largest markets in regenerative medicine. Our technology has shown great potential for disc disease, a spectrum of conditions for which current treatments generally attempt to address the symptoms rather than repair the damaged tissue.”
